Abstract

This contribution deals with an educating tool called PN Designer, developed to support Petri Nets education - design, simulation, properties analysis and testing. It helps students to master Petri Nets and can also be used to examine students’ knowledge. Teachers are able to prepare various tasks that can then be used in the learning and/or assessment process. To support the assessment process the server part was designed to provide test creation, distribution, and automated evaluation facilities. Although primarily devoted to Tablet PCs, with some loss of comfort the environment can be used on traditional computers as well. The results show a great deal of the attractiveness of this kind of learning, and substantial time saving in the assessment process while preserving the assessment quality.
